Commit Graph

5595 Commits (master)

Author SHA1 Message Date
clifford bc833e43c4 Clifford Wolf:
I accidentally the default setting for example017.scad



git-svn-id: http://svn.clifford.at/openscad/trunk@252 b57f626f-c46c-0410-a088-ec61d464b74c
2010-01-09 17:27:23 +00:00
clifford 4eafcadda1 Clifford Wolf:
Fixed operator bindings (oops)



git-svn-id: http://svn.clifford.at/openscad/trunk@251 b57f626f-c46c-0410-a088-ec61d464b74c
2010-01-09 17:25:35 +00:00
clifford dd817ad903 Clifford Wolf:
Added mirror statement



git-svn-id: http://svn.clifford.at/openscad/trunk@250 b57f626f-c46c-0410-a088-ec61d464b74c
2010-01-09 17:15:56 +00:00
kintel 3b7ba5c69c sync
git-svn-id: http://svn.clifford.at/openscad/trunk@249 b57f626f-c46c-0410-a088-ec61d464b74c
2010-01-09 15:51:02 +00:00
kintel a93e4fd53d DXF test cases
git-svn-id: http://svn.clifford.at/openscad/trunk@248 b57f626f-c46c-0410-a088-ec61d464b74c
2010-01-09 15:50:45 +00:00
kintel 5f5952a542 ELLIPSE support
git-svn-id: http://svn.clifford.at/openscad/trunk@247 b57f626f-c46c-0410-a088-ec61d464b74c
2010-01-09 15:50:15 +00:00
clifford 961f5e5991 Clifford Wolf:
Fixed segfault on invalid polygon/polyhedron vetrex indices



git-svn-id: http://svn.clifford.at/openscad/trunk@246 b57f626f-c46c-0410-a088-ec61d464b74c
2010-01-09 12:23:49 +00:00
kintel 3939d27266 sync
git-svn-id: http://svn.clifford.at/openscad/trunk@245 b57f626f-c46c-0410-a088-ec61d464b74c
2010-01-09 10:36:07 +00:00
kintel 0e62c23559 minor const fix
git-svn-id: http://svn.clifford.at/openscad/trunk@244 b57f626f-c46c-0410-a088-ec61d464b74c
2010-01-09 10:13:57 +00:00
kintel 6a5a8f3b7d Mac OS X release script update
git-svn-id: http://svn.clifford.at/openscad/trunk@243 b57f626f-c46c-0410-a088-ec61d464b74c
2010-01-09 10:13:26 +00:00
kintel 3ea99b46ac minor update
git-svn-id: http://svn.clifford.at/openscad/trunk@242 b57f626f-c46c-0410-a088-ec61d464b74c
2010-01-09 06:32:50 +00:00
clifford 9497dd9f91 Clifford Wolf:
Avoid bogus 'used ininitialized' compiler warning



git-svn-id: http://svn.clifford.at/openscad/trunk@241 b57f626f-c46c-0410-a088-ec61d464b74c
2010-01-08 21:29:24 +00:00
clifford ad31c81344 Clifford Wolf:
TODOs



git-svn-id: http://svn.clifford.at/openscad/trunk@239 b57f626f-c46c-0410-a088-ec61d464b74c
2010-01-08 20:43:23 +00:00
kintel a943518e6d doc
git-svn-id: http://svn.clifford.at/openscad/trunk@238 b57f626f-c46c-0410-a088-ec61d464b74c
2010-01-08 14:23:14 +00:00
clifford a6b676a75e Clifford Wolf:
TODOs



git-svn-id: http://svn.clifford.at/openscad/trunk@237 b57f626f-c46c-0410-a088-ec61d464b74c
2010-01-08 04:33:32 +00:00
clifford 36eb2d48c7 Clifford Wolf:
Fixed dumping/caching of import_* statements



git-svn-id: http://svn.clifford.at/openscad/trunk@236 b57f626f-c46c-0410-a088-ec61d464b74c
2010-01-08 03:35:04 +00:00
clifford 8df04678d0 Clifford Wolf:
Use "file" and "layer" in import_* instead of "filename" and "layername"
	(the old argument names are still supported for compatibility)



git-svn-id: http://svn.clifford.at/openscad/trunk@235 b57f626f-c46c-0410-a088-ec61d464b74c
2010-01-08 03:31:06 +00:00
clifford fb23336741 Clifford Wolf:
Fixed positional argument processing of import_* statements



git-svn-id: http://svn.clifford.at/openscad/trunk@234 b57f626f-c46c-0410-a088-ec61d464b74c
2010-01-08 02:57:13 +00:00
clifford b888c2e05a Clifford Wolf:
Improved rendering of non-CSG blocks in OpenCSG mode



git-svn-id: http://svn.clifford.at/openscad/trunk@233 b57f626f-c46c-0410-a088-ec61d464b74c
2010-01-07 23:21:45 +00:00
clifford 97c484efb9 Clifford Wolf:
Added Design->FlushCaches menu action



git-svn-id: http://svn.clifford.at/openscad/trunk@232 b57f626f-c46c-0410-a088-ec61d464b74c
2010-01-07 21:08:47 +00:00
clifford 65ee513661 Clifford Wolf:
Added rotate_extrude statement()



git-svn-id: http://svn.clifford.at/openscad/trunk@231 b57f626f-c46c-0410-a088-ec61d464b74c
2010-01-07 20:49:27 +00:00
kintel df24accdf0 sync
git-svn-id: http://svn.clifford.at/openscad/trunk@230 b57f626f-c46c-0410-a088-ec61d464b74c
2010-01-07 18:44:02 +00:00
clifford f00385d9c6 Clifford Wolf:
TODO update



git-svn-id: http://svn.clifford.at/openscad/trunk@229 b57f626f-c46c-0410-a088-ec61d464b74c
2010-01-07 18:35:37 +00:00
kintel 3979047163 I accidentally the whole \! operator
git-svn-id: http://svn.clifford.at/openscad/trunk@228 b57f626f-c46c-0410-a088-ec61d464b74c
2010-01-07 15:46:57 +00:00
clifford daddf419b0 Clifford Wolf:
Added color() statement



git-svn-id: http://svn.clifford.at/openscad/trunk@227 b57f626f-c46c-0410-a088-ec61d464b74c
2010-01-07 14:59:10 +00:00
clifford a74cb7f221 Clifford Wolf:
Fixed status/progress output of linear_extrude()



git-svn-id: http://svn.clifford.at/openscad/trunk@226 b57f626f-c46c-0410-a088-ec61d464b74c
2010-01-07 13:55:48 +00:00
clifford ebcaa02c94 Clifford Wolf:
Indenting fixes



git-svn-id: http://svn.clifford.at/openscad/trunk@225 b57f626f-c46c-0410-a088-ec61d464b74c
2010-01-06 22:27:24 +00:00
kintel b9049ed91e sync
git-svn-id: http://svn.clifford.at/openscad/trunk@224 b57f626f-c46c-0410-a088-ec61d464b74c
2010-01-06 21:35:31 +00:00
kintel 480c3badb1 bugfix: recent files were broken, added File->Close, simplified file I/O using QTextStream, removed side-effect of find_root_node
git-svn-id: http://svn.clifford.at/openscad/trunk@223 b57f626f-c46c-0410-a088-ec61d464b74c
2010-01-06 21:35:01 +00:00
clifford c342e41e2f Clifford Wolf:
Added polygon() statement
	Added min/max functions



git-svn-id: http://svn.clifford.at/openscad/trunk@222 b57f626f-c46c-0410-a088-ec61d464b74c
2010-01-06 19:58:54 +00:00
clifford 9326da227b Clifford Wolf:
Disabled dxftess.cc debug output



git-svn-id: http://svn.clifford.at/openscad/trunk@221 b57f626f-c46c-0410-a088-ec61d464b74c
2010-01-06 19:58:29 +00:00
kintel 6fdfde289b Fixed typos in classnames
git-svn-id: http://svn.clifford.at/openscad/trunk@220 b57f626f-c46c-0410-a088-ec61d464b74c
2010-01-06 19:38:45 +00:00
meta a96752e378 windows icon file
git-svn-id: http://svn.clifford.at/openscad/trunk@219 b57f626f-c46c-0410-a088-ec61d464b74c
2010-01-06 12:58:22 +00:00
clifford 8747d50236 Clifford Wolf:
Added linear extrusion of 2d nef data



git-svn-id: http://svn.clifford.at/openscad/trunk@218 b57f626f-c46c-0410-a088-ec61d464b74c
2010-01-06 12:16:56 +00:00
clifford bc128ab631 Clifford Wolf:
Tesselation magic: cgal 2d and 3d nefs have different constraints on
	the tesselation results



git-svn-id: http://svn.clifford.at/openscad/trunk@217 b57f626f-c46c-0410-a088-ec61d464b74c
2010-01-06 11:40:18 +00:00
clifford 47827e9c59 Clifford Wolf:
Tiny fix in import_dxf parameter processing



git-svn-id: http://svn.clifford.at/openscad/trunk@216 b57f626f-c46c-0410-a088-ec61d464b74c
2010-01-06 11:03:35 +00:00
clifford 2ff53c89ce Clifford Wolf:
Added caching of messages along wioth synthesis products



git-svn-id: http://svn.clifford.at/openscad/trunk@215 b57f626f-c46c-0410-a088-ec61d464b74c
2010-01-06 10:48:51 +00:00
clifford 6575732286 Clifford Wolf:
Fixed inner-borders-bug in 2d visualization
	(symptom: rendering artefacts even with higher
	convexity setting as it should be needed)



git-svn-id: http://svn.clifford.at/openscad/trunk@214 b57f626f-c46c-0410-a088-ec61d464b74c
2010-01-06 09:21:40 +00:00
clifford 73e84ec660 Clifford Wolf:
Indenting fix



git-svn-id: http://svn.clifford.at/openscad/trunk@213 b57f626f-c46c-0410-a088-ec61d464b74c
2010-01-06 06:07:23 +00:00
kintel bc88fb8c39 Mac compile for for non-cgal builds
git-svn-id: http://svn.clifford.at/openscad/trunk@212 b57f626f-c46c-0410-a088-ec61d464b74c
2010-01-06 04:14:01 +00:00
kintel b45ac89d50 Automatically add missing suffix to save filename
git-svn-id: http://svn.clifford.at/openscad/trunk@211 b57f626f-c46c-0410-a088-ec61d464b74c
2010-01-06 04:12:50 +00:00
clifford c484e4ea39 Clifford Wolf:
TODOs housekeeping



git-svn-id: http://svn.clifford.at/openscad/trunk@210 b57f626f-c46c-0410-a088-ec61d464b74c
2010-01-06 03:29:51 +00:00
clifford a2ad604ef4 Clifford Wolf:
Added import_dxf statement



git-svn-id: http://svn.clifford.at/openscad/trunk@209 b57f626f-c46c-0410-a088-ec61d464b74c
2010-01-06 02:35:21 +00:00
clifford 255826eeb5 Clifford Wolf:
Added DXF export for 2d data (command line and GUI)



git-svn-id: http://svn.clifford.at/openscad/trunk@208 b57f626f-c46c-0410-a088-ec61d464b74c
2010-01-06 02:04:49 +00:00
clifford e71c3ce4c9 Clifford Wolf:
Added 2d render() support



git-svn-id: http://svn.clifford.at/openscad/trunk@207 b57f626f-c46c-0410-a088-ec61d464b74c
2010-01-06 01:40:28 +00:00
clifford 6f2f0016d1 Clifford Wolf:
Improved 3d view of rendered 2d data



git-svn-id: http://svn.clifford.at/openscad/trunk@206 b57f626f-c46c-0410-a088-ec61d464b74c
2010-01-05 23:17:06 +00:00
clifford 8d732c87aa Clifford Wolf:
Some housekeeping



git-svn-id: http://svn.clifford.at/openscad/trunk@205 b57f626f-c46c-0410-a088-ec61d464b74c
2010-01-05 21:10:39 +00:00
clifford 966eb8f55e Clifford Wolf:
Added missing "N.dim != 0" checks as needed e.g. for "if (false);" child nodes
	(fixes bug reported by Andrew Plumb)



git-svn-id: http://svn.clifford.at/openscad/trunk@204 b57f626f-c46c-0410-a088-ec61d464b74c
2010-01-05 20:38:33 +00:00
clifford a02e00083f Clifford Wolf:
New hack for 2d transformations:
	create DxfData, transform, tess to polyset, recreate nef



git-svn-id: http://svn.clifford.at/openscad/trunk@203 b57f626f-c46c-0410-a088-ec61d464b74c
2010-01-05 19:09:01 +00:00
kintel 8457c079e3 Update on recently fixed items
git-svn-id: http://svn.clifford.at/openscad/trunk@202 b57f626f-c46c-0410-a088-ec61d464b74c
2010-01-05 17:43:14 +00:00